What to Consider When Choosing a Robot Vacuum:

Choosing the ideal robot vacuum includes more than simply selecting the flashiest model. Thoroughly think about the following aspects to ensure you choose a gadget that truly fulfills your requirements and supplies value:
Budget: Robot vacuums vary in rate from under ₤ 200 to over ₤ 1000. Determine your budget plan upfront to narrow down your choices. Remember that greater price points frequently associate with more advanced features like smarter navigation, stronger suction, and self-emptying abilities.Floor Types: Consider the dominant floor key ins your home. Houses with mainly tough floorings might gain from models with mopping functions, while homes with thick carpets need strong suction power and brush roll designs crafted for carpet cleaning. Some designs are flexible and perform well on both tough floorings and carpets.Pet Ownership: Pet hair is a common cleaning difficulty. If you have family pets, look for robot vacuums specifically designed to deal with pet hair. These frequently feature tangle-free brush rolls, robust suction, and reliable purification systems to record allergens.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or those with numerous levels may demand robot vacuums with longer battery life and smart mapping functions to make sure complete cleaning protection. Residences with complex designs and numerous obstacles will take advantage of advanced navigation systems.Smart Features and Connectivity: Do you desire app control, scheduling, virtual walls, or voice assistant integration? Smart includes boost benefit and customisation but often come at a greater cost.Navigation and Mapping:Random Bounce: Basic models frequently use random bounce navigation, which is less efficient however can still clean up effectively in smaller sized spaces.Organized Navigation (LiDAR or Camera-based): More sophisticated models use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or camera-based systems to map your home and browse methodically. This causes more effective cleaning, room-by-room cleaning, and the capability to set virtual limits.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power identifies how efficiently a robot vacuum chooses up dirt and debris. Greater suction is typically better, specifically for carpets and pet hair.Battery Life and Charging: Battery life dictates the length of time the robot vacuum can work on a single charge. Consider the size of your home and pick a design with sufficient battery life to clean it successfully. Automatic charging is a standard function, where the robot returns to its dock when the battery is low.Self-Emptying Feature: Some premium designs feature self-emptying bases. These bases immediately suck the dust and particles from the robot's dustbin into a bigger, disposable bag, substantially decreasing the frequency of manual dustbin clearing and boosting benefit.Noise Level: Robot vacuums vary in sound output. If sound level of sensitivity is a concern, try to find designs marketed as quiet operating.

Tips for Getting one of the most Out of Your Robot Vacuum:

To ensure your robot vacuum runs efficiently and effectively for several years to come, think about these useful ideas: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ot vacuum, declutter your floors by eliminating loose cables, small toys, and other barriers that might impede its navigation or get tangled in the brushes.Routine Maintenance: Empty the dustbin routinely (or less regularly with self-emptying designs), clean the brushes and filters as advised by the maker, and look for any blockages or wear and tear.Schedule Cleaning Sessions: Utilize the scheduling function to set your robot vacuum to tidy instantly at practical times, such as when you are at work or asleep.Use Virtual Boundaries: If your robot vacuum has virtual wall or zoned cleaning features, use them to prevent the robot from entering particular areas or to target cleaning to specific rooms.Monitor Performance: Occasionally observe your robot vacuum in action to ensure it is cleaning successfully and navigating properly. Address any issues without delay.Keep Software Updated: If your robot vacuum has app connectivity, ensure you keep the firmware and app updated to benefit from the most current features and efficiency enhancements.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s):
Q: Are robot vacuums worth the investment?A: For hectic individuals and those seeking to minimize their cleaning work, robot vacuums can be a rewarding financial investment. They automate a tedious task and can preserve a consistently cleaner home.Q: Can robot vacuums change traditional vacuums totally?A: Robot vacuums are outstanding for regular maintenance cleaning but might not totally change standard vacuums for deep cleaning tasks, corner cleaning, or cleaning upholstery and stairs. Numerous users discover they supplement their robot vacuum with a traditional vacuum for more intensive cleaning.Q: How often should I run my robot vacuum?A: Daily cleaning is ideal for preserving a regularly clean home, especially in homes with animals or kids. Nevertheless, you can adjust the frequency based on your needs and home traffic.Q: Do robot vacuums work on carpets and carpets?A: Yes, lots of robot vacuums are created to work on both difficult floorings and carpets. Try to find designs with strong suction and brush rolls developed for carpet cleaning performance.Q: How long do robot vacuums typically last?A: With proper upkeep, a good quality robot vacuum can last for numerous years, typically 3-5 years or longer depending upon usage and brand.Q: Are robot vacuums noisy?A: Robot vacuums typically produce less noise than conventional vacuums, however noise levels vary between designs. Some models are particularly created for quieter operation.Q: What is the difference in between LiDAR and camera-based navigation?A: L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) uses lasers to produce an in-depth map of your home, using exact navigation and efficient cleaning paths. Camera-based systems utilize visual information to navigate. LiDAR is normally considered more precise and effective in low-light conditions.
